You don’t have to be a webmaster in orderĀ to customize the signature on your Microsoft Outlook email. Just follow the easy steps below to create a signature that reinforces your web persona.
To add an image to your signature
- Start by selecting the graphic or logo that you want as part of your signature.
- Save the graphic/ logo of your preference to your computer. For ease of access this can be done right on your desktop.
- Open your MS Outlook account.
- In Outlook (usually at the top) go to Tools and then go to Options. You should see some tabs; click on the Mail Format tab.
- Under Mail Format go to the Signatures. In your Signature box, select where you want to put the image
- Click on the picture icon that has a mountain and a sun in a box. A window will pop up with your files.
- Go to the folder where you saved the graphic / logo and click insert to get the icon. The icon should show up in the signatures.
To Connect the Image in your signature to Facebook or your website:
- Make sure you are not logged into Facebook before you start. (You will need the URL to be displayed without extra stuff on it)
- In Outlook select the image. It should show with a black border around it with squared dots inside.
- Click on the hyperlink icon that is next to the picture icon that has looks like the earth with a chain in front.
- A window will pop up and this is where you will enter your Facebook link or the link to your website.
- Make sure the button on the left called Existing File or Web page is selected. No need to look in the documents folder here.
- After that, click on ok and ok to exit.
- You can repeat these steps to add other icons with different links as well.
